     62 // as_integer
     63 
     64 template<typename V, typename S, typename F>
     65 inline
     66 V
     67 as_integer_helper(const string& func, const S& str, size_t* idx, int base, F f)
     68 {
     69     typename S::value_type* ptr = nullptr;
     70     const typename S::value_type* const p = str.c_str();
     71     typename remove_reference<decltype(errno)>::type errno_save = errno;
     72     errno = 0;
     73     V r = f(p, &ptr, base);
     74     swap(errno, errno_save);
     75     if (errno_save == ERANGE)
     76         throw_from_string_out_of_range(func);
     77     if (ptr == p)
     78         throw_from_string_invalid_arg(func);
     79     if (idx)
     80         *idx = static_cast<size_t>(ptr - p);
     81     return r;
     82 }

    179 // as_float
    180 
    181 template<typename V, typename S, typename F>
    182 inline
    183 V
    184 as_float_helper(const string& func, const S& str, size_t* idx, F f )
    185 {
    186     typename S::value_type* ptr = nullptr;
    187     const typename S::value_type* const p = str.c_str();
    188     typename remove_reference<decltype(errno)>::type errno_save = errno;
    189     errno = 0;
    190     V r = f(p, &ptr);
    191     swap(errno, errno_save);
    192     if (errno_save == ERANGE)
    193         throw_from_string_out_of_range(func);
    194     if (ptr == p)
    195         throw_from_string_invalid_arg(func);
    196     if (idx)
    197         *idx = static_cast<size_t>(ptr - p);
    198     return r;
    199 }

    356 // as_string
    357 
    358 template<typename S, typename P, typename V >
    359 inline
    360 S
    361 as_string(P sprintf_like, S s, const typename S::value_type* fmt, V a)
    362 {
    363     typedef typename S::size_type size_type;
    364     size_type available = s.size();
    365     while (true)
    366     {
    367         int status = sprintf_like(&s[0], available + 1, fmt, a);
    368         if ( status >= 0 )
    369         {
    370             size_type used = static_cast<size_type>(status);
    371             if ( used <= available )
    372             {
    373                 s.resize( used );
    374                 break;
    375             }
    376             available = used; // Assume this is advice of how much space we need.
    377         }
    378         else
    379             available = available * 2 + 1;
    380         s.resize(available);
    381     }
    382     return s;
    383 }
